Đến nội dung


Hình ảnh
- - - - -

Tặng anh em thư viện kết cấu block thuộc tính


  • Please log in to reply
7 replies to this topic

#1 amosis

amosis

    biết vẽ line

  • Members
  • PipPip
  • 26 Bài viết
Điểm đánh giá: 4 (bình thường)

Đã gửi 22 July 2011 - 10:08 PM

Tặng anh em block thuộc tính hotrocad chạy trên autocad tất cả các phiên bản
ngoài ra còn một số lisp hay sử dụng cũng được cập nhật
anh em down về cài cả 2 file hotrocad và file update ra có hướng dẫn ngoài desktop thực hiện theo hướng dẫn
Anh em góp ý tại topic này
cảm ơn đã quan tâm!
Một số hình ảnh em nó :D
Hình đã gửi
Hình đã gửi
Hình đã gửi
Hình đã gửi
Hình đã gửi
Hình đã gửi
Hình đã gửi

link : http://www.mediafire...ggodbatp7fyzd14
link update : http://www.mediafire...uojjbk9cfaubglq
pass : hanviquan.tk
Lưu ý cài cả 2 file dung lượng 3.31 MB

  • 3
Nhà mới : http://xaydungit.vn/

#2 Thaistreetz

Thaistreetz

    biết lệnh adcenter

  • Advance Member
  • PipPipPipPipPipPipPip
  • 903 Bài viết
Điểm đánh giá: 505 (tốt)

Đã gửi 23 July 2011 - 10:22 AM

nhận xét qua cho bạn:
- ứng dụng của bạn lỗi tùm lum te le luôn. lỗi do thiếu hàm con, lỗi do sử dụng command để vẽ đói tuợng nhưng set biến hệ thống không tốt dẫn đến đối tuợng vẽ ra bay lung tung hết cả; có thể lỗi nguyên nhân còn do cấu trúc hàm command thay đổi giữa các phiên bản cad nên cad của mình (2010) không vẽ ra đuợc cái gì cả.
- ứng dụng của bạn rất vụn vặt. là kết quả do bạn tự viết, đồng thời một số là bạn gom nhặt trên diễn đàn và một số tác giả khác nên có lẽ chỉ chạy ổn định đuợc với máy của bạn. sang máy của nguời khác dễ bị xung đột với hàm và biến trong các ứng dụng của họ. viết 1 ứng dụng kiêm nhiệm nhiều thứ, nhiều lệnh thế mà lại viết và tổ chức rời rạc như vậy không lỗi mới lại. bạn nên tổ chức thành 1 project để dễ kiểm soát.
- Chương trình thống kê thép của bạn có giao diện khá thân thiện với người dùng, mình thấy rất thích dù kết quả thì cũng chưa biết thế nào vì không chạy được :D
  • 0

Hình đã gửi
IN HIM, I TRUST. THE TRUST IN MY GOD


#3 amosis

amosis

    biết vẽ line

  • Members
  • PipPip
  • 26 Bài viết
Điểm đánh giá: 4 (bình thường)

Đã gửi 23 July 2011 - 02:03 PM

- Thực ra ứng dụng chỉ mang tính phục vụ cá nhân là chính ai thấy hợp thì dùng không thì thôi, dẫn đến các công cụ có thể không hợp với nhiều người, mặt khác do trình độ có hạn, thấy cái này hay lại cho thêm vào, cái kia hay lại thêm vào nên "vụn vặt" như bạn nói (Rất cảm ơn)
- Mình đã thử trên nhiều máy chạy rất ổn định, bản thân cũng đang sử dụng 2 cad là 2007 và 2010 để test không có lỗi mới build
- Phần nào lỗi, hay lỗi tất cả mong bạn chỉ rõ để khắc phục, đừng chung chung khi muốn góp ý vấn đề gì, rất mong góp ý
- Hiện tại đã có >100 lượt down ứng dụng nhưng chưa có ý kiến gì, Cảm ơn bạn đã quan tâm cho ý kiến!
  • 0
Nhà mới : http://xaydungit.vn/

#4 Tue_NV

Tue_NV

    KS Võ Quang Tuệ

  • Moderator
  • PipPipPipPipPipPipPip
  • 4296 Bài viết
Điểm đánh giá: 3804 (đỉnh cao)

Đã gửi 23 July 2011 - 03:04 PM

- Thực ra ứng dụng chỉ mang tính phục vụ cá nhân là chính ai thấy hợp thì dùng không thì thôi, dẫn đến các công cụ có thể không hợp với nhiều người, mặt khác do trình độ có hạn, thấy cái này hay lại cho thêm vào, cái kia hay lại thêm vào nên "vụn vặt" như bạn nói (Rất cảm ơn)
- Mình đã thử trên nhiều máy chạy rất ổn định, bản thân cũng đang sử dụng 2 cad là 2007 và 2010 để test không có lỗi mới build
- Phần nào lỗi, hay lỗi tất cả mong bạn chỉ rõ để khắc phục, đừng chung chung khi muốn góp ý vấn đề gì, rất mong góp ý
- Hiện tại đã có >100 lượt down ứng dụng nhưng chưa có ý kiến gì, Cảm ơn bạn đã quan tâm cho ý kiến!

1. Góp ý :
Bạn chưa set biến hệ thống INSUNITS khi chèn Block. Đơn vị chèn giữa bản vẽ gốc với bản vẽ hiện hành (bản vẽ sẽ Insert) là như nhau hay biến hệ thống INSUNITS giữa bản vẽ gốc với bản vẽ hiện hành (bản vẽ sẽ Insert) bằng nhau . Nếu không khi chèn vào, hình vẽ sẽ không như ý của mình.
Khi chèn vào, nên Explode ra để thấy cái Block Dynnamic

2. Những cái dầm mặt cắt ngang : Nên thay Text bằng ATTribute để có thể sửa được. Nên viết thêm phần Thống kê cho tất cả các loại dầm mặt cắt thì tuyệt vời hơn.

3. Dầm mặt cắt chỉ sử dụng chỉ sử dụng cho 1 mẫu nhất định. Nên làm sao cho để sử dụng được nhiều hơn. Bạn vẽ với 1 loại điển hình -> Sau đó, những cái còn lại, có thể cho User vẽ thêm vào. Mình nghĩ sẽ hiệu quả hơn.

Ví dụ 1: Bạn tạo 1 mẫu dầm mặt cắt trên có 5 cây, lỡ trên có 4 cây hoặc 3 cây, hoặc là 2 cây thì sao? Tue_NV nghĩ đơn giản là chỉ tạo 2 cây thép trên là đủ. Phát sinh User có thể vẽ thêm hoặc có thể sử dụng lệnh Ncopy để copy đối tượng từ Block để vẽ thêm.

Ví dụ 2 : Bạn tạo ra các mẫu dầm có cánh, thế trường hợp dầm không cánh thì sao (Lanh tô không ô văng) là 1 loại dầm không cánh)? Hoặc giả dụ dầm có cánh trên và cánh dưới(hình chữ Z) thì sao? Lại phải đi tạo 1 mẫu dầm mới nữa à?
-> Giải quyết đơn giản là Visible thêm 1 cái là ẩn hiện biên cánh để User có thể vẽ thêm vô theo ý thích của mình

Thấy bạn viết là : Phien ban ho tro cad nguon mo, .... sao mình thấy có file Lib.vlx mã nguồn đóngnhỉ? Bạn post lầm chăng?


  • 0

#5 amosis

amosis

    biết vẽ line

  • Members
  • PipPip
  • 26 Bài viết
Điểm đánh giá: 4 (bình thường)

Đã gửi 23 July 2011 - 08:48 PM

Cảm ơn đóng góp chân tình, mình sẽ học hỏi và bổ sung theo ý kiến bạn!
Xin bạn hướng dẫn thêm cách sử dụng Text bằng ATTribute ?
  • 0
Nhà mới : http://xaydungit.vn/

#6 Detailing

Detailing

    biết lệnh imageclip

  • Members
  • PipPipPipPipPipPipPip
  • 667 Bài viết
Điểm đánh giá: 278 (khá)

Đã gửi 23 July 2011 - 09:05 PM

Cảm ơn đóng góp chân tình, mình sẽ học hỏi và bổ sung theo ý kiến bạn!
Xin bạn hướng dẫn thêm cách sử dụng Text bằng ATTribute ?

Bạn dùng lệnh ATTDEF (tạo Attribute) thay cho lệnh DT (tạo text) trong Block
Khi insert block bằng code bạn thêm đoạn code để edit attribute nữa là được.
Thân!
  • 0

Ideas don't matter, execution does!

1908412_308002392716743_8165279281236341


#7 denxixi

denxixi

    Chưa sử dụng CAD

  • Members
  • Pip
  • 2 Bài viết
Điểm đánh giá: 0 (bình thường)

Đã gửi 24 July 2011 - 12:11 AM

cảm ơn bác về tiện ích này.Em dùng cad 07,sau khi cài đặt,chạy update và đọc huớng dẫn như bác nói,em vào cad phải dùng lệnh ap load hết các lisp trong phần hỗ trợ cad ở ổ C thì mới sử dụng đuợc các tính năng thống kê thép,san nền,các lisp liên quan.Còn phần block thuộc tính như bác nói thì em ko sử dụng đuợc:( đánh các lệnh vào thì nó báo là ko hiểu lệnh này(unknown).......mong bác sớm tìm ra lỗi và cập nhật bản khác hoàn thiện hơn.
  • 0

#8 Tue_NV

Tue_NV

    KS Võ Quang Tuệ

  • Moderator
  • PipPipPipPipPipPipPip
  • 4296 Bài viết
Điểm đánh giá: 3804 (đỉnh cao)

Đã gửi 24 July 2011 - 07:22 AM

Cảm ơn đóng góp chân tình, mình sẽ học hỏi và bổ sung theo ý kiến bạn!
Xin bạn hướng dẫn thêm cách sử dụng Text bằng ATTribute ?

Chào bạn amosis
Bạn tham khảo ý kiến trên của bạn Detail và bạn nên chú ý đến việc sử dụng biến hệ thống ATTREQ để hiển thị hoặc không hiển thị hộp thoại Edit ATTributes theo ý đồ của mình và cũng để các máy khác chạy đúng

Cũng rất cảm ơn lời cảm ơn chân tình của bạn. Tuy nhiên, bạn chưa trả lời câu này của Tue_NV.
Bạn đã viết là Phiên bản hỗ trợ CAD mã nguồn mở? Sao lại có file bị "đóng"? Bạn có thể post file lib.lsp mã nguồn mở lên theo đúng như lời bạn viết không?

.........
Thấy bạn viết là : Phien ban ho tro cad nguon mo, .... sao mình thấy có file Lib.vlx mã nguồn đóngnhỉ? Bạn post lầm chăng?


  • 0